NEWS 3. HANDS ON HEADS


It is no secret that Hands on Heads are comprised of four of the people who work with Upset the Rhythm (myself included). But what may be less well known is that the band will be splitting up at the end of August, as drummer Chukka is moving to Australia for the foreseeable future.

To celebrate the end of an era, we are releasing our new album, which includes tracks from two recording sessions from the last year or so. At the moment you can purchase our handmade CDs from the webshop (http://www.upsettherhythm.co.uk/shop.shtml) for £6 including postage within the UK, and we hope to release a vinyl edition later in the year.

There will be one or two last chances to catch us play, and we'd love to see some of you there:
